COP ignition coils function by converting low-voltage electrical input into the high-voltage spark needed to ignite the air-fuel mixture in each cylinder. NGK's coil design incorporates robust insulation and precision winding to handle repeated thermal cycling without degradation, a critical factor in engine bay environments where temperatures fluctuate dramatically during extended driving. Proper installation requires disconnecting the battery, removing the defective coil, and seating the new unit firmly onto the spark plug terminal; no special tools or wiring modifications are necessary on most vehicles equipped with COP systems. Regular coil inspection during spark plug service helps catch early wear and prevents the compounding issues that arise when ignition coils begin to fail.
